Abbas

/AH-B-AA-S/

Boy Muslim Arabic origin ArabIndian

Lion, the fierce and stern one — Abbas ibn Ali was the half-brother of Husayn who fought at Karbala with legendary bravery, carrying the battle standard and fetching water for the besieged children even after both his arms were severed. His name carries the martial valour of a warrior whose devotion outlasted his body, the fierce loyalty of brotherhood tested unto death, and the Shia mourning tradition that commemorates his sacrifice every Muharram
